    Efficient Multi-Authority Attribute-Based Searchable Encryption Scheme with Blockchain Assistance for Cloud-Edge Coordination

    Peng Liu1, Qian He1,*, Baokang Zhao2, Biao Guo1, Zhongyi Zhai1

    CMC-Computers, Materials & Continua, Vol.76, No.3, pp. 3325-3343, 2023, DOI:10.32604/cmc.2023.041167

    Abstract Cloud storage and edge computing are utilized to address the storage and computational challenges arising from the exponential data growth in IoT. However, data privacy is potentially risky when data is outsourced to cloud servers or edge services. While data encryption ensures data confidentiality, it can impede data sharing and retrieval. Attribute-based searchable encryption (ABSE) is proposed as an effective technique for enhancing data security and privacy. Nevertheless, ABSE has its limitations, such as single attribute authorization failure, privacy leakage during the search process, and high decryption overhead.
